How to wash silk ties


Neckties are easy to get dirty after being filtered. Do not wash them in the hands and wash them in the washing machine. They should be sent to a dry cleaner and cleaned by a professional laundry technician. Otherwise, they will fade and shrink, resulting in a crumpled feeling. If it's not very dirty, you can do it yourself.


One is the wet cleaning method. The second is the dry cleaning method.

Wet tie


Method one


You can put the tie in warm soapy water at about 30 ℃ for 1-3 minutes, gently brush with the brush along the lines of the tie, do not brush hard, or rub it arbitrarily. After washing, rinse with 30 ℃ water clean. After that, press the ironing method as above. If the washed necktie is out of shape, the seam behind the necktie can be disassembled, the tie's fabric and interlining can be ironed flat, and then sewed as it is.


Method Two


Put the tie on a paper template, scrub with a soft brush or foam plastic with the replacement detergent, then wipe off the foam with a dry towel, and then scrub with a clean wet towel.

Dry-clean tie


method one


Take a small amount of alcohol or gasoline with a cotton ball, wipe it gently to remove stains, then put a damp white cloth on it and iron with an electric iron. The temperature during ironing is determined by the material used for the tie. It can't be too high (below 70 ℃); the temperature of woolen silk can be higher (below 170 ℃).


Method Two


Dip a soft brush into a small amount of gasoline, and brush the stains along the warp and weft of the tie fabric. After the gasoline smell evaporates, wipe it with a clean wet towel several times.
